Default Any Ideas??

my a/c is not blowing very much, but it is still blowing cold, and when I open the hood, it is all frosty and the lines are real sweaty....anyone know why this is happeneing??

Originally Posted by YellowTA1
my a/c is not blowing very much, but it is still blowing cold, and when I open the hood, it is all frosty and the lines are real sweaty....anyone know why this is happeneing??
Whenever a system freezes up ( home or auto ) it is usually one of two things low freon or more often air flow. Check your evap coil its probably either has no filter and is clogged or the filter is clogged and cant pull enough air through it. j
